You start by making the first layer.
Mix the flour, melted butter and nuts.
Spread into 9×13 pan and bake.
Start on the second layer.
Mix together cream cheese, powdered sugar and cool whip.
Spread over 1st layer.
Put in fridge to cool.
Mix together pudding.
Pour over second layer.
Even out the layer.
Top with remaining cool whip.
Store in fridge until ready to serve.

Robert Redford Dessert:
1st Layer:
1 1/2 cups flour
1 1/2 sticks melted butter
1/2 cup chopped nuts
2nd Layer:
1 cup powdered sugar
1 8 oz. package softened cream cheese
1 cup cool whip
3rd Layer:
1 large package instant pudding mix (I prefer chocolate)
3 cups milk
4th Layer:
remaining cool whip
Mix 1st layer and press into 9×13 pan, will seem skimpy – just keep flattening it out in the pan. Bake 15 minutes at 375 degrees. Remove and cool. Mix 2nd layer together and spread over 1st layer. Place in fridge to cool. Mix the pudding with milk and whip for 2 minutes. Spread over second layer. Spread remaining cool whip over all and chill. Garnish with chopped nuts or chocolate shavings.

I saw on FB page someone asked why it was named “Robert Redford Desssert” – my Mom always told me that it used to be called “Better Than Sex Dessert”, one time someone said even better than sex with Robert Redford and also proper lady’s did not use the word sex nor were they to associate it with their dessert so people just started calling it “Robert Redford” – true or not I have no idea but totally makes sense to me!!!!!!
